Chick N' Gun is an indie precision platformer for PC in which players guide groups of small chicks through a dangerous nugget factory run by a hungry antagonist. The core experience centers on quick thinking, creative use of movement and tools, and a willingness to sacrifice individual chicks so others can progress. Each run emphasizes tight timing, as the chicks have roughly ten seconds before they risk becoming nuggets themselves.
Gameplay
The gameplay loop revolves around platforming challenges across handcrafted levels. Players control multiple chicks at once, directing them through tight spaces, hazards, and obstacles while managing limited time. Sacrifice plays a central role: one chick can block threats or trigger mechanisms to clear a path for the rest of the group. Platforming demands precision, with jumps, climbs, and timing sequences that reward careful positioning and momentum control.
A gun adds another layer of interaction. Players deploy it in creative ways to interact with the environment, clear paths, or handle threats without relying solely on movement. This tool integrates directly into the platforming, encouraging experimentation rather than straightforward shooting. The visual style blends cute chick designs with dark humor and gore elements, creating a contrast that fits the factory escape theme.
Game Modes
Chick N' Gun focuses on a singleplayer campaign built around sequential levels rather than separate named modes. Progression involves tackling each handcrafted stage in order, refining routes and mechanics to improve completion times and survival rates. The emphasis stays on individual skill development, with no multiplayer or competitive variants confirmed in the game's design.
Levels vary in layout and challenge, pushing players to adapt their approach each time. The absence of additional modes keeps the experience centered on the core escape loop and the pressure of the ten-second timer.
Key Features
Several elements define the game's identity. Players manage hundreds of cute chicks across runs, using their numbers strategically through sacrifice mechanics. Dark humor and gore graphics appear consistently in the factory setting and character interactions. The gun supports varied applications beyond basic combat, tying into platforming creativity. Every level receives individual handcrafting to present unique obstacles and solutions.
These features combine into a merciless precision platformer that rewards mechanical improvement and fast decision-making. The short time limit per chick heightens tension and encourages repeated attempts to find optimal paths.
